A fellow I met on one of my trips moved to Albuquerque and is trying to get a fabrication business started here so he offered to make me some custom bumpers. I'm posting these not because he wants to start taking orders (it's not a mail-order project), but because I really liked his design! Its light, stylish, and super-strong--with welded-on braces. It took him most of a week to do the front as it was all welding (i.e. no bends!). I hope to get it painted or powedrcoated soon while he works on the rear bumper and tire mount.
